Fuse Specifications

If your microwave is not turning on it could be due to your fuse needing to be replaced. This part protects the microwave by shutting it off if there is an electrical surge. This fuse is just over an inch long, is metallic on both ends and ceramic in the middle. Before beginning this repair, unplug the appliance and wait a few minutes before starting. Remove the outer cabinet which is held in place with two screws. You will then locate the power cord which will lead you to the fuse holder. Determine if the fuse has blown. Using an ohmmeter, you should be able to figure out if it has blown. A proper reading is zero ohms, if it reads as anything else then your fuse has in fact blown. Simply snap the old fuse out of place and place the new one in.

How can I locate the part holding the fuse? The device doesn't turn on i think is the fuse, but I don't know where the fuse box is located in the device.
For model number MH1170XSS2
PartSelect logo
Hi Bob, Thank you for your question. Make sure to unplug your appliance. To get to your fuse, you will have to remove your grille from above your door and you will have to unscrew and remove your control panel. There is a small metal vent on the top right hand side of your appliance, your fuse is located in there. Be very careful. If you do not release the charge from your capacitor, you may get electrocuted. You can release the charge with a screw driver with an insulated handle. I hope that helps. Control panel, clock, light, turntable all work, but unit does not heat. Does the fuse control all power to all parts? In other words, could my problem be simply the fuse even though the control panel, etc. Still work or do I have a bigger problem? Thanks.
For model number GH6178XPQ0
PartSelect logo
Hi Jay, Thank you for the question. Normally if the appliance seems to be working as normal other then the heat the fuse will be fine. Sounds like you need to replace the Magnetron, This part is used to generate microwave energy/heat. Hope this helps!

This is a Whirlpool Microwave. Do you replace the fuse in the same way as a customer by the name of Arnie asked about replacing the fuse in a different brand?
For model number MH2155XPB0
PartSelect logo
Hi Laurie, Thank you for your question. Here are some detailed instructions that you may reference for information on how to replace the fuse. NOTE: If you are not comfortable doing this yourself, please get an electrician to do this repair. Before you begin any repair, please unplug the appliance from the electrical outlet. Use a Phillips head screwdriver to unthread the screws securing the grill. With the screws removed, open the microwave oven door then the slide the grill to the left and lift up to remove it. Next remove the control panel mounting screw and then lift the control panel up to detach. Then remove the screw holding the inner access panel and then release the panel from the retaining clips. To avoid injury, you will need to release the potentially dangerous charge from the capacitor by placing a screwdriver with an insulated handle across the terminals. Be careful not to touch the metal portion of the tool. We have included a link from our website that you may reference for more information on how to discharge the capacitor. Use pliers to detach the old fuse from the noise filter board. Install the new fuse by snapping it into the bracket. Replace the inner access panel and secure it with the screws. Now insert the control panel tabs into the slots in the frame and push the panel down. Secure it with the mounting screw. Insert the tabs of the grill into the frame and slide it to the right. Shut the oven door and then secure the grill with the screws. Plug the power cord back in and the microwave should now work. We hope this helps. 2 weeks ago I replaced the fuse because the only thing working was the time on the front panel. Microwave was working great until yesterday when I came home and noticed that the light was on inside, but the door was shut. As soon as I opened the door, it tripped the breaker. Any ideas?
For model number WMH53520AE0
PartSelect logo
Hi Matt, Thank you for your question. If your microwave is blowing the fuses, the issue may be with the microwave door switches. If the switches are malfunctioning of if the door is misaligned, this can cause the breaker to trip. This may also be caused by a short in the controller near the line cord that feeds power into the microwave unit. The cooling fan motor in your microwave may have also failed and this would cause the fuse to blow. You will need to inspect the parts to verify what is causing the issue. Also, make sure the microwave has its own dedicated outlet. If there are too many appliances plugged into the same circuit, the breaker will trip. We hope this helps. Thank you and have a great day.
